HAND PAINTED VINYL JACKETS FOR NEW ALBUM

22 May, 2021 | Return|

FRIENDS..

Well Springtime really hit hard this year!  Hope you are feeling okay and not too crazed like myself. Suddenly, the traveling option to my job has opened wide up again and certain decisions have to be made.

The new album comes out August 27th on BLACK MESA RECORDS, who will have a pre-order link up soon for CDs and Vinyl and digital, but in the meantime I am working to fulfill my Patreon and Kickstarter campaigns with painted vinyl and other goodies. I am painting 100 individual jackets for this run. When I am done fulfilling orders, whatever is left will go up for auction to help me pay for the recording of this album, which I am very excited to share with you.
